R60705 Alloy vs. AWS ER110S-1

R60705 alloy belongs to the otherwise unclassified metals classification, while AWS ER110S-1 belongs to the iron alloys. There are 20 material properties with values for both materials. Properties with values for just one material (8, in this case) are not shown.

For each property being compared, the top bar is R60705 alloy and the bottom bar is AWS ER110S-1.
